FROM quay.io/fedora/fedora-bootc:40
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
# bootupd currently does not support Raspberry Pi-specific firmware and bootloader files.
|
||||||
|
# This shim script copies the firmware and bootloader files to the correct location before
|
||||||
|
# calling the original bootupctl script.
|
||||||
|
# This is a temporary workaround until https://github.com/coreos/bootupd/issues/651 is resolved.
|
||||||
|
RUN dnf install -y bcm2711-firmware uboot-images-armv8 && \
|
||||||
|
cp -P /usr/share/uboot/rpi_arm64/u-boot.bin /boot/efi/rpi-u-boot.bin && \
|
||||||
|
mkdir -p /usr/lib/bootc-raspi-firmwares && \
|
||||||
|
cp -a /boot/efi/. /usr/lib/bootc-raspi-firmwares/ && \
|
||||||
|
dnf remove -y bcm2711-firmware uboot-images-armv8 && \
|
||||||
|
mkdir /usr/bin/bootupctl-orig && \
|
||||||
|
mv /usr/bin/bootupctl /usr/bin/bootupctl-orig/ && \
|
||||||
|
dnf clean all
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
COPY bootupctl-shim /usr/bin/bootupctl

# Fedora bootc image for Raspberry Pi
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
> This is experimental at this moment. Horrible hacks are included.
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
This is a bootc-powered Fedora base image compatible with Raspberry Pi. See
|
||||||
|
https://docs.fedoraproject.org/en-US/bootc/ for more information about bootc and Fedora.
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
The main difference between the base Fedora image and this repository is that this repository's Containerfile patches
|
||||||
|
bootupd so it can handle Raspberry Pi-specific bootloader and firmware files under /boot/efi that are needed
|
||||||
|
to successfully boot a Pi. See https://github.com/coreos/bootupd/issues/651 for more information about what's needed
|
||||||
|
in bootupd.
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
## Use
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
Clone this repository on an aarch64 machine and run:
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
```
|
||||||
|
sudo podman build -t localhost/fedora-bootc-raspi:40 .
|
||||||
|
mkdir output
|
||||||
|
sudo podman run \
|
||||||
|
--rm \
|
||||||
|
-it \
|
||||||
|
--privileged \
|
||||||
|
--pull=newer \
|
||||||
|
--security-opt label=type:unconfined_t \
|
||||||
|
-v $(pwd)/output:/output \
|
||||||
|
-v /var/lib/containers/storage:/var/lib/containers/storage \
|
||||||
|
quay.io/centos-bootc/bootc-image-builder:latest \
|
||||||
|
--type raw \
|
||||||
|
--local \
|
||||||
|
--rootfs ext4 \
|
||||||
|
localhost/fedora-bootc-raspi:40
|
||||||
|
# arm-image-installer can deal only deal with xz archives, let's deal with that
|
||||||
|
xz -v -0 -T0 output/raw/disk.raw
|
||||||
|
# substitute /dev/sda with your root disk
|
||||||
|
sudo arm-image-installer --target=rpi4 --media=/dev/sda --image output/raw/disk.raw.xz --resizefs
|
||||||
|
```
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
If you want a user inside the image, add `-v $(pwd)/config.toml:/config.toml` to `podman-run` and create the following blueprint in `config.toml`:
|
||||||
|
```
|
||||||
|
[[customizations.user]]
|
||||||
|
name = "alice"
|
||||||
|
password = "$6$..."
|
||||||
|
key = "ssh-ed25519 AAAA..."
|
||||||
|
groups = ["wheel"]
|
||||||
|
```
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
Alternatively, just add a layer with a user.
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
## Known issues
|
||||||
|
The horrible bootupd hack currently cannot update the Raspberry Pi specific firmware and bootloader. This means that
|
||||||
|
you are stuck with their versions from the initial disk image, unless you manually update them.

#!/bin/bash
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
if [[ $# -ge 2 ]]; then
|
||||||
|
if [[ "$1" == "backend" && "$2" == "install" ]]; then
|
||||||
|
# BASH_ARGV[0] is the last argument. In the case of bootupctl backend install, it's the path to the target
|
||||||
|
# root directory.
|
||||||
|
echo "Copying Raspberry Pi firmware files to ${BASH_ARGV[0]}/boot/efi/" >&2
|
||||||
|
cp -av /usr/lib/bootc-raspi-firmwares/. "${BASH_ARGV[0]}"/boot/efi/
|
||||||
|
echo "Copying Raspberry Pi firmware files finished" >&2
|
||||||
|
fi
|
||||||
|
fi
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
exec /usr/bin/bootupctl-orig/bootupctl "$@"
